WebAssembly: Microsoft.VisualStudio.Utilities.dll Stores a reusable MemoryStream. The MemoryStream will only be stored for reuse if its Capacity does not exceed the maximumStreamCapacity used when constructing the ReusableMemoryStream. Internally this will just set an index and empty the array, but the internal data structures will be … survivor.io 2WebDec 30, 2016 · How can we reuse memory streams? Just set the length to zero! Internally this will just set an index and empty the array, but the internal data structures will be preserved for future use. There must be a way to do this in a simple manner li barbri 1lWebApr 21, 2024 · The memorystream does not have a reset/clear method because it would be redundant. By setting it to zero length you clear it. Of course you could always do: memoryStream = new MemoryStream (memoryStream.Capacity ()); Copy.
